Two Indian-Americans selected for White House Fellows programme


Tina shah and Anjali Tripathi selected for the prestigious White House Fellows programme among the 30 finalists. Tina Shah, a physician from the University of Chicago and Anjali Tripathi, an astrophysics Ph.D candidate at Harvard University, have been shortlisted for the White House Fellows Programme, the White House said on Thursday. Two Indian-Americans have been named finalists for the prestigious White House Fellows programme that offers first hand experience of working at the highest levels of the US federal government. Shah and Tripathi were among the 30 finalists selected for the programme, founded in 1964 by President Lyndon B Johnson. The National Finalists will be evaluated by the President’s Commission on White House Fellowships in Washington, DC from June 9-12, a media release said.
